Urban refers to GYPSYs as “one who thinks they are the main character of a very special story.” It is true that every human is special in some way and lives a unique life, but GYPSYs’ dreams are much more exaggerated than that, and when they do not reach their goals they are unhappy. Urban states that GYPSY’s parents instilled ideas within their children that in turn made them “wildly ambitious.” GYPSYs grew up believing what their parents told them, but took it further in believing that they are the absolute best in their pursuits causing them to be “delusional” (Urban). Lastly, Urban states that GYPSYs are unhappy because they allow themselves to be falsely intimidated by other GYPSYs who seem to be living the life of their dreams, but are just as miserable as they are. After pointing out his beliefs of why Gen Y Yuppies are unhappy, Urban tells what they must do to fix their unhappiness. He starts by encouraging GYPSYs to continue to dream and pursue their goals, but to stop thinking that they are destined to be at the top of their fields directly out of college.
